The Federal Capital Territory Administration FCTA has impounded nearly 300 vehicles for indiscriminate parking, road unworthiness, and offering taxi services without formal registration.

Director, FCT Directorate of Road Traffic Service DRTS, Abdulateef Bello disclosed this Friday in Abuja during enforcement operations in some parts of the city.Bello said that with the renewed directive of the FCT Minister, Nyesom Wike to clean the city of nuisances, the service will not relent in its effort to ensure that offenders are punished.

While calling on road users to obey traffic rules and regulations, Bello disclosed that the service was working with the Fact Transport Secretariat to ensure policy implementation towards zero tolerance to traffic violations in FCT. He said; “The Minister, Barr. Nyesom Wike on the assumption of office, actually observed some high level of nuisances in various degrees in the city center and the entire territory and he has read his riot act that, the territory must be clean of all these within a specified period.
